On Thu, Apr 19, 2012 at 2:43 PM, Simone Bordet <[email protected]> wrote: > Hi, > > On Thu, Apr 19, 2012 at 01:41, Devon Lazarus <[email protected]> > wrote: > > Hi, > > > > > > > > I’ve been trying to get to the bottom of what I believe is a performance > > problem in a Jetty application. Unfortunately, I’ve hit a road block and > > could use some help. Googling hasn’t shed any light on the issue. Neither > > has stackoverflow. > > > > > > > > Basically, I’m seeing very high CPU load without a lot of throughput. To > > quantify that, we have a c1.medium (dual core) running Ubuntu 10.04LTS in > > EC2 with Jetty 7.6.2 configured at 50 min/200 max threads, a single > > acceptor, and the Oracle JDK 1.7_03 JVM configured with -mx2048m –ms512m, > > and some GC tuning. > > > > > > > > We’re using a custom load generation tool to find the point at which the > > server falls over. However, we’re hitting 90% CPU burn with loads well > over > > 2 while handling ~25 concurrent transactions/second (throughput was 63 > tps > > with ~400ms response times). That just doesn’t seem right (way too low). > > > > > > > > In profiling the JVM regardless of load (low or under siege), we can see > > clearly that 99% of our CPU time is spent in one of two places: > > > > > > > > sun.nio.ch.SelectorImpl.select() at 66% > > > > sun.nio.ch.ServerSocketChannelImpl.accept() at 33% > > Are you using SSL ? > > We have fixed a couple of issues regarding threads spinning in 7.6.3. > Is there any chance you can try that version out ? > > If you still get the same behavior in 7.6.3, then we're really > interested in knowing more details. > > Thanks, > > Simon > -- > http://cometd.org > http://intalio.com > http://bordet.blogspot.com > ---- > Finally, no matter how good the architecture and design are, > to deliver bug-free software with optimal performance and reliability, > the implementation technique must be flawless.
